Premium Gym Art for the Next Level: Kristin Bonn at FIBO 2026

The FIBO 2026 exhibition once again demonstrated the importance of visual atmosphere in modern training environments. A significant highlight was the presentation by Kristin Bonn at stand 10.2A01, where she showcased a selection of premium gym art designed to strengthen the identity of studios, gym chains, and strength brands through powerful visual statements.

Art as an Expression of Strength and Identity

The focus of the exhibition was on large-format originals, limited print editions, and insights into the world of custom commissions. Drawing on over zehn years of international commission experience, Kristin Bonn translates athlete, brand, or studio identities into enduring signature pieces. These works are designed to serve as permanent fixtures in various spaces, from reception areas and training floors to exclusive VIP zones.

A central theme was the connection between athletic achievement and artistic narrative. For instance, the work "Samson Mr.O 2024 - narrative sketch" illustrated how individual symbolism—such as references to cultural heritage or life journeys—can tell a story. Other pieces like "Push (2023)" and "Andi's 666pounds (2020)" made the mental strength and fighting spirit behind athletic records visually tangible.

Value Addition for Studios and Brands

For gym operators, boutique studio owners, and franchise systems, the showcased solutions offered clear value. By combining high-quality aesthetics with a strong visual language, the perceived value of a space is elevated. These artworks do more than decorate; they provide clear market differentiation and serve as a strong visual backdrop for social media content.

The exhibited pieces, such as the monumental "Schwarzenegger compilation (2021)" or the large-scale "Muscle Beach (2024)", demonstrated how targeted motifs—including historical references and bodybuilding legends—can create an inspiring atmosphere. Such works are designed to foster user motivation and sustainably shape the character of a training environment.
